Abstract:

The dynamic characteristics of self-anchored suspension bridges is experimented and analyzed using the way of non-linear dynamic time history. And based on it, the effect of non-linear viscous damper on the shock-resistant capability of this bridge is studied. The results indicated that the calculated model of suspended bridge built by beam and bar elements can be used to the seismic responsive analysis of structure, whose result is reliable. When the non-linear viscous dampers with proper parameters are installed along the lengthwise direction of main bridge, the control regional relative displacement of structure is reduced effectively. The seismic response effect of vital positions is improved to some extent. Meanwhile, these confirm that the viscous damper has good dissipation energy and damped effect too.
